What is the impact of public perception on the UPSC examination process? 🔊
Public perception significantly impacts the UPSC examination process by influencing both the candidates' psyche and the broader narrative surrounding the exams. Positive views on the integrity and inclusiveness of the examination process can enhance candidate morale. However, any perceived biases or inconsistencies may lead to decreased trust and increased tension among aspirants. The public's understanding of the UPSC's role in shaping governance affects how candidates approach their studies, highlighting the importance of ethical practices in civil service. Furthermore, media representation can shape societal expectations of what constitutes a successful civil servant.
